According to my source, the late Peter Stevenson, builder of several cyclekarts, was inspired to create this one by a German Schuco tin toy which was based on the Mercedes W25 from the mid-30s. It also says that the cyclekart's name is spelt "Brannan Special", in honour of the car driven by Clark Gable's pilot character (Mike Brannan) in the 1950 film "To Please a Lady", which it also resembles. That car was a 1948 Don Lee-bodied Kurtis.
